The Magic Bullet Combo Blender with a 48oz pitcher is a powerful and versatile blender designed for various blending tasks. Here's what you can expect from this product: *Key Features:* - *Powerful Motor*: This blender boasts a 500-Watt motor base, making it capable of handling tough ingredients like frozen fruit, smoothies, and sauces. - *48oz Pitcher*: The large pitcher attachment allows for multiple servings of your favorite blends, perfect for family or friends. - *Simple Speed Dial*: The blender features a straightforward control with blend high, blend low, and pulse options, giving you precise control over the consistency of your blends. - *Easy Cleaning*: The blender is designed for hassle-free cleaning, with a twist-off blade and dishwasher-safe parts. - *Combo Unit*: Some versions of this blender come with a to-go cup with lid, perfect for taking your smoothies on the move ¹ ². *Product Specifications:* - *Model Numbers*: MBF50100, MBF50200 - *Colors*: Available in all black and silver - *Warranty*: 1-year limited warranty Read more

If you’re expecting the Magic Bullet Combo Blender to come in and perform open-heart surgery like a Vitamix on steroids, you’re gonna be disappointed. But if you’re looking for a budget-friendly beast that holds its own in everyday smoothie chaos? This thing slaps. I’ve been running it through its paces with cold foods such as protein shakes, frozen fruit smoothies, overnight oats that needed pulverizing into oblivion, and it’s handled all of it like a champ. Blades are sharp, suction cups are no joke (seriously, this thing sticks), and it powers through frozen chunks with way more confidence than I expected at this price point. No problems with leakage either, which makes cleanup a breeze. The motor isn’t silent, but it’s not jet-engine loud either. Somewhere in the “yes, I’m blending something and it’s 7:42 AM, deal with it” range. The controls are super intuitive, which I appreciate! No guessing, no 27-button interfaces. Just press, pulse, blend, go. Have I tried it with hot liquids or soups yet? Not yet. I’ve read the warning about not blending boiling stuff unless you want to repaint your kitchen ceiling, so I’ll tread carefully. But for my day-to-day cold blending needs? I’m genuinely impressed. Is it a Vitamix? No. But for the price, you’re getting serious performance and reliability without having to sell a kidney. Would absolutely recommend for students, smoothie queens, chaotic cat moms (hi), or anyone just trying to eat something healthy without a fight. ⭐ 4 stars because I save my 5s for life-changers, but this is real close.
